黑狐家游戏

智能音乐平台源码架构与开发实践,基于微服务与云原生技术的全链路解析,歌曲网站源码是什么

欧气 1 0

(全文约1580字,原创技术解析)

平台架构设计原理 本系统采用"四层三横"微服务架构,包含用户服务层、内容服务层、业务服务层和智能分析层,横向打通支付网关、消息队列、配置中心等基础设施,形成完整的云原生技术栈,核心架构包含:

智能音乐平台源码架构与开发实践,基于微服务与云原生技术的全链路解析,歌曲网站源码是什么

图片来源于网络,如有侵权联系删除

  1. 容器化部署:基于Kubernetes的动态调度机制,支持横向扩展与滚动更新
  2. 分布式事务:采用Seata AT模式保障跨服务事务一致性
  3. 服务网格:Istio实现智能路由与流量监控
  4. 灰度发布:通过Nginx的动态权重分配实现A/B测试

核心模块开发实践

智能推荐引擎

  • 基于Spark的实时推荐系统
  • 融合用户行为日志(30+行为特征)
  • 使用TensorFlow构建深度神经网络模型
  • 推荐结果缓存策略(Redis+Memcached)
  • 每日更新机制(Hadoop离线计算+Flink实时计算)

多模态音乐处理

  • FFmpeg音视频转码引擎
  • MP3/WAV/FLAC多格式转换
  • 360°音质增强算法(AI降噪+动态EQ)
  • 3D音频空间渲染技术

区块链版权管理

  • 基于Hyperledger Fabric的版权存证
  • 智能合约自动执行版税分配
  • NFT数字音乐卡牌系统
  • 版权交易链上存证

关键技术选型对比

  1. 前端框架:Vue3+TypeScript(性能提升40%)
  2. 后端框架:Spring Cloud Alibaba(微服务优化)
  3. 数据库:TiDB分布式HTAP数据库(读写分离)
  4. 缓存方案:Redis Cluster(主从复制+哨兵)
  5. 消息队列:RocketMQ(事务消息+消息溯源)
  6. 容器平台:OpenShift(企业级运维支持)

安全防护体系构建

三级认证机制:

  • 第一级:OAuth2.0开放授权
  • 第二级:JWT令牌动态刷新
  • 第三级:生物特征二次验证

网络安全防护:

  • DDoS防御(基于Anycast的流量清洗)
  • WAF防火墙(规则库自动更新)
  • CDN安全策略(IP信誉过滤)

数据安全:

  • 敏感信息加密(AES-256+SM4)
  • 数据脱敏中间件
  • 隐私计算联邦学习

安全审计:

  • 全链路操作日志(ELK+Kibana)
  • 实时异常行为检测(Prometheus+Grafana)
  • 自动化安全扫描(SonarQube)

性能优化专项方案

响应时间优化:

  • 前端代码压缩(Webpack Tree Shaking)
  • API响应缓存(Cache-aside模式)
  • 异步任务队列(RabbitMQ死信队列)

系统吞吐量提升:

  • 分库分表策略(按用户ID哈希分布)
  • 数据库索引优化(复合索引+覆盖索引)
  • 读写分离配置(主库+3个从库)

资源利用率:

  • 智能资源调度(CRI-O容器运行时)
  • 磁盘IO优化(ZFS压缩+SSD缓存)
  • 内存管理(JVM参数调优+GC日志分析)

智能运营体系实现

智能音乐平台源码架构与开发实践,基于微服务与云原生技术的全链路解析,歌曲网站源码是什么

图片来源于网络,如有侵权联系删除

用户画像系统:

  • 200+标签体系构建
  • 动态标签更新(Flink实时计算)
  • 用户分群算法(K-means聚类)

会员成长体系:

  • 多维度成长路径设计
  • 动态权益配置引擎
  • 智能任务推荐系统

数据驾驶舱:

  • 100+核心指标监控
  • 自定义看板生成
  • 自动预警系统(基于Prometheus Alertmanager)

未来演进路线图

  1. 2024Q3:AI创作助手(集成Stable Diffusion)
  2. 2025Q1:元宇宙音乐厅(Web3D+VR)
  3. 2025Q4:区块链NFT音乐发行
  4. 2026:边缘计算节点部署
  5. 2027:全球音乐版权联盟

典型技术难点突破

跨时区同步问题:

  • 采用NTP分布式时钟服务
  • 时间戳校准算法(PTP协议)
  • 时区动态配置中心

大文件传输优化:

  • 断点续传(HTTP Range)
  • 分片上传(Multipart)
  • CDN智能路由选择

全球化部署:

  • 多区域多语言支持
  • 本地化合规适配
  • 文化差异处理机制

质量保障体系

自动化测试:

  • Selenium+Appium端到端测试
  • JMeter压力测试(5000+并发)
  • SonarQube代码质量扫描

持续交付:

  • GitLab CI/CD流水线
  • 滚动回滚机制
  • 混沌工程实践

监控体系:

  • Prometheus+Grafana监控
  • ELK日志分析
  • APM全链路追踪(SkyWalking)

本系统通过技术创新实现了音乐平台从传统架构到智能生态的全面升级,日均处理量达到5000万次请求,系统可用性达到99.99%,用户留存率提升35%,未来将持续深化AI技术与区块链的融合创新,构建全球化的数字音乐生态体系。

(注:本方案包含23项技术专利,涉及分布式系统、智能推荐、版权保护等领域,已通过国家版权局软件著作权认证)

标签: #歌曲网站源码

黑狐家游戏
  • 评论列表

留言评论